Though most homeowners don't think about their roof every single day, a roof plays a vital role in keeping a home safe and secure. Be on the lookout for these signs that your roof might need professional attention.
Your roof's age and material are key factors. Asphalt shingles, the most popular residential roofing material, generally last around 20–25 years before needing replacement. Schedule a professional inspection if your roof is approaching or past this lifespan to determine if full replacement is needed.
Leaks are a definite sign that your roof needs repair. Stains on insulation, ceilings, or walls, or in your attic often signal that water is getting through worn or damaged shingles. Even small leaks should be taken care of right away, as they can cause mold and more harm over time.
If you can see roof deck boards or sheathing under shingles, it means that those shingles are curling or losing their seal. This means it's time for replacement. Shingles need to lie flat to stop water from leaking into your home.
Inspect your shingles thoroughly from ground level or a sturdy ladder. Look for ones that have cracks or that are missing granules. Over time, storms can cause surface damage. To keep your roof in good condition, replace any shingles that are no longer attached properly or have gaping holes.
Roof flashing makes a watertight seal around chimneys, valleys, vents, and other areas where water can penetrate your roof. Peeling, cracked, or deteriorated flashing can allow leaks. We recommend quickly addressing any problems with the roof flashing that come up.
An uneven roofline may be a sign of a structural issue that requires professional evaluation. Without taking steps to fix or replace it, a sagging roof will continue to worsen.

In Rhode Island, residential roofing contractors must be registered with the Contractor's Registration and Licensing Board (commercial roofing contractors require additional licensure). When registering, contractors must submit proof of general liability and workers' compensation insurance. In Rhode Island, written contracts are required for any job valued over $1,000.

Generally, spring or fall is the best time of year to have your roof replaced. Winter may not be the ideal time to have work done on your roof in Warren, as cold weather can delay work or simply be unpleasant.
Insulation is important to consider, since a home with good insulation lowers your energy costs from heating and cooling your home. Spray foam insulation is one of the best kinds because it is long-lasting and moisture-resistant. It also seals gaps and cracks, which prevents leaks. However, it is also more expensive than other types of insulation.
